The official DVD release of Goodfellas has been reissued multiple times, with the most common version being a two-disc "Special Edition" that features the film in its original 1.85:1 widescreen aspect ratio. These official DVDs typically featured the film in English Dolby Digital 5.1 surround sound, alongside a " dubbed Spanish " dialogue track, which is precisely the "Latino" audio option we are discussing. However, some early DVD pressings had a notorious error on the container, erroneously claiming a Spanish soundtrack when it was not present; later releases corrected this issue. The official release also included a plethora of special features, including commentary from Martin Scorsese and various cast members, production notes, and theatrical trailers.

No discussion of Goodfellas is complete without Tommy DeVito. Joe Pesci created one of the most terrifying characters in film history—a man whose volatility is his defining trait. The "Funny how?" scene is a masterclass in tension. It captures the absurdity and danger of mob life, where a compliment can turn into a death sentence in a heartbeat.
